
Adult Ministries
Life doesn’t stand still, and neither does faith. At St. Matthew’s, our Adult Ministries are all about creating space for growth, connection, and support in every season of life. Whether you’re looking to deepen your understanding of scripture, build meaningful friendships, or simply find a place to belong, there’s a place for you here.
We believe faith is something we live together. That means asking questions, sharing experiences, and learning from one another along the way. Our adult ministry opportunities are designed to meet you where you are, whether you’re new to church life or have been walking in faith for years.
Bible Studies
Open Scripture, ask questions, and grow in understanding together. Our Bible studies are welcoming spaces where everyone can engage at their own pace. Whether you are brand new to the Bible or have been studying it for years, you will find thoughtful conversation and meaningful insight.
Small Groups
Faith deepens through relationships. Small groups offer a chance to connect more personally with others in the congregation. These gatherings are a place to share life, support one another, and grow together in faith in a relaxed and friendly setting.
Classes and Seasonal Studies
Throughout the year, we offer classes and short-term studies that explore a variety of topics. These may follow the church season or focus on specific areas of faith and life. They are a great way to learn something new and engage more deeply for a season.
Fellowship and Connection
Sometimes the most meaningful moments happen in simple conversation. From casual gatherings to special events, Adult Ministries creates opportunities to build friendships and enjoy time together. These connections are an important part of living out our faith as a community.
At the heart of it all is our shared mission to proclaim the love of God for all people. Adult Ministries is one of the ways we live that out, by growing in faith and supporting one another as we go.
